Porous Aggregates of Unidirectionally Oriented (NH4)3PW12O40 Microcrystallites: Epitaxial Self-Assembly
Microcrystallites of (NH4)3PW12O40 self-assembled to form symmetric dodecahedral aggregates (ca. 0.5–6 μm in size) in which the microcrystallites joined together with the same crystal orientation, by controlled deposition of NH4 salts from a heated aqueous solution of H3PW12O40. Zusammenfassung: | Microcrystallites of (NH4)3PW12O40 self-assembled to form symmetric dodecahedral aggregates (ca. 0.5–6 μm in size) in which the microcrystallites joined together with the same crystal orientation, by controlled deposition of NH4 salts from a heated aqueous solution of H3PW12O40. These aggregates were highly porous, where microcrystallies were connected each other by epitaxial interfaces. |
